Overview:

Bourke is situated in the far northwest of New South Wales, approximately 800 kilometers from Sydney. Its remote location is part of its charm, offering residents a serene and close-knit community in a picturesque outback setting. Bourke is often referred to as the "Gateway to the Outback" due to its position on the banks of the Darling River, making it a significant stopover for travelers exploring the Australian interior.


Culture and Lifestyle:

Bourke's culture is deeply rooted in its Indigenous heritage, with the local Ngemba and Barkindji peoples playing a vital role in the community. The town celebrates its Indigenous heritage through events, art, and cultural festivals, offering residents a chance to learn and immerse themselves in this rich history.

Heritage:

Bourke is steeped in history, with many heritage-listed buildings showcasing its past. The historic Crossley Engine, which once pumped water to the town, is a notable landmark. Visitors and residents alike can explore the Bourke Historic Cemetery and other heritage sites to gain a deeper understanding of the town's past.

Local Jobs and Employment:

Bourke's economy is primarily based on agriculture, tourism, and local businesses. Employment opportunities can be found in farming, tourism-related ventures, and retail. The tight-knit community often supports local businesses, creating a strong local economy.

Climate and Greenery:

Bourke experiences a semi-arid climate, with hot summers and mild winters. The town's proximity to the Darling River ensures some greenery in the region, and its stunning sunsets are a testament to its unique natural beauty.


Events and Adventure:

Bourke hosts various events and festivals throughout the year, including the Bourke Easter Festival and Back O' Bourke Show. Adventure seekers can explore the nearby national parks and rivers, offering outdoor activities like fishing, camping, and hiking.
